Focaccia di Recco is two paper thin layers of dough, filled with oozy, melted cheese. A traditional Italian dish.


 

Nothing like focaccia bread that you may know well, when this turned up at our table we were in for a treat. Full name Focaccia Di Recco alla Crescenza, this is two layers of paper thin dough (yeast-free) filled with oozy melted cheese. ‘Crescenza’ being the name of the traditional cheese of choice.
